BMW 5 series engine produces 7 HP less power than Mercedes E class, whereas torque is 60 NM less than Mercedes E class. Despite less power, BMW 5 series reaches 100 km/h speed 0.2 seconds faster.

The BMW 5 series is a better choice when it comes to fuel economy.
By specification BMW 5 series consumes 1 litres less fuel per 100 km than the Mercedes E class, which means that by driving the BMW 5 series over 15,000 km in a year you can save 150 litres of fuel.
By comparing actual fuel consumption based on user reports, BMW 5 series consumes 0.8 litres less fuel per 100 km than the Mercedes E class.

In general, the longer and for more car models an engine is produced, the better its serviceability and availability of spare parts. BMW 5 series might be a better choice in this respect.

The turning circle of the BMW 5 series is 0.4 metres less than that of the Mercedes E class, which means BMW 5 series can be easier to manoeuvre in tight streets and parking spaces.

BMW 5 series has fewer problems.
According to annual technical inspection data Mercedes E class has serious deffects in 10 percent more cases than BMW 5 series, so BMW 5 series quality is probably slightly better
